Transaction 01714305ff48877977f94ac787a024ceafb162e21f24b8cfeb81a882e366ac24
1 Input
1 Output
-
01714305ff48877977f94ac787a024ceafb162e21f24b8cfeb81a882e366ac24:0
- value
- 654000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c4edd1ebb1cb38256c13eedce657881b20dfc09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13agPvQ9zJ7Wo559JroZvJSrtUcJZx4cLo